When it comes to natural remedies for anxiety and stress, Rhodiola Rosea is at the top of the list.

The native plant of Arctic Siberia is Rhodiola Rosea, which is another name for Golden Root. It has a long history of use in eastern European and Asian medicine for a variety of conditions, including increased stamina, productivity on the job, resistance to high altitude sickness, and the treatment of mental and physical exhaustion, melancholy, anemia, impotence, gastrointestinal issues, infections, and neurological diseases.

Rhodiola rosea, formerly known as rodia riza, was originally mentioned in 'De Materia Medica' by the Greek physician Dioscorides in 77 C.E. for therapeutic purposes. Since 1969, Rhodiola Rosea has been a part of the official Russian medical system.

Rhodiola Rosea has been around for a long time, but the Western world is just now learning about its health advantages. Studies evaluating its effects in reducing stress and anxiety have brought it to the attention of numerous natural health practitioners.

An adaptogen is what Rhodiola Rosea is thought to be. This means it stabilizes the body as a whole without interfering with other processes. Its potential to restore hormonal balance suggests it could be useful in the treatment of anxiety and depression.

Research on Rhodiola Rosea has shown that it increases the impact of neurotransmitters by stimulating them. One example is the brain's capacity to digest serotonin, a neurotransmitter that aids in stress adaptation.

Researchers have looked at the effects of adaptogens on physical, chemical, and biological stress because they enhance the body's capacity to deal with stress in general.

Intense mental labor (like final exams) can generate stress, so researchers looked into how Rhodiola Rosea can help. The results of these studies showed that Rhodiola Rosea increased both the quantity and quality of work, while also improving concentration and decreasing the impact of exhaustion.

Physical and mental forms of stress and anxiety have both been investigated for potential Rhodiola Rosea effects. As stated in a research by the American Botanical Council, "Most users find that it improves their mood, energy level, and mental clarity." In addition, they discuss research that found Rhodiola Rosea protected the cardiovascular system and brain against the physiological effects of stress while simultaneously increasing tolerance to stress.

Research on the general health advantages of Rhodiola Rosea was detailed in this paper.

The usual dosage range is 200-600 mg daily. At least 0.8% salidroside and 3% rosavin are required for the active ingredients.

Buyers should be aware that Rhodiola can be diluted with species that do not possess the same therapeutic qualities as Rhodiola Rosea, or offered at doses that are not effective. When dealing with signs of sadness or anxiety, everyone should consult a medical expert.
